How Government Exam Notifications Work

When Are Notifications Released?

Government exam notifications are released on official websites. Usually 2-3 months before the exam date. Sometimes earlier (6 months for UPSC), sometimes later (1 month for banking).

UPSC Notifications: Released on upsc.gov.in. Usually released 5-6 months before the exam. For example: IAS prelims happens in May → Notification released in November-December.

SSC Notifications: Released on ssc.nic.in. Usually released 2-3 months before exam.

Banking Notifications: Released on ibps.in. Usually released 1-2 months before exam.

State Exams: Released on state government websites. Timing varies widely.

Common Notification Mistakes (Avoid These)

Mistake #1: Not Tracking Release Dates
Problem: You know exam date but not notification release date. You start preparing without applying. By the time you apply, deadline has passed.
Solution: Track both notification release AND application deadline dates.

Mistake #2: Assuming Same Dates Every Year
Problem: “SSC CGL happens in March every year.” Actually, dates vary. Sometimes Feb-March, sometimes April-May.
Solution: Check official website for current year dates. Don’t assume.

Mistake #3: Only Checking Official Website Once
Problem: You checked in January, found no notification. Forgot to check in March when notification was actually released.
Solution: Check weekly or subscribe to email alerts.

Mistake #4: Missing Notification Announcements
Problem: Notification was released but you didn’t see it. You were busy preparing, didn’t check updates.
Solution: Set phone reminders. Subscribe to emails. Follow social media.

Mistake #5: Not Applying Within Deadline Window
Problem: You knew about notification but procrastinated. Applied on last day. Website crashed. Deadline passed.
Solution: Apply within first 2-3 days of deadline opening. Don’t wait until last moment.

Time Between Notification and Exam (How Long to Prepare)

UPSC IAS: Notification to Prelims = 5-6 months. Plenty of time if you’ve been preparing.

SSC CGL: Notification to Tier 1 = 2-3 months. Tight timeline. Should have started preparation before notification.

Banking (IBPS): Notification to Preliminary = 1-2 months. Very tight. Must have prepared months in advance.

Railway (RRB): Notification to Exam = 2-3 months. Standard timeline.

Key Learning: Government exams don’t give you 6 months after notification. They give you notification after assuming you’ve been preparing. Start preparation early. Track notifications. Apply immediately when notification releases.

Notification Release Patterns (By Month)

December-January: UPSC IAS, UPSC NDA, UPSC CAPF, SSC CGL, SSC CHSL, SSC GD, RRB NTPC, RRB Group D

February-March: SSC JE, SBI PO (sometimes), State police exams

April-May: IBPS notifications (sometimes), Teaching exams

June-July: Occasional exams, state-specific notifications

August-September: IBPS PO, IBPS Clerk, IBPS RRB, UPTET, Teaching exams

October-November: State police exams, occasional national exams

Pattern isn’t fixed but generally these months see more notifications. Check websites more actively during these months.
